Developing Unique SVG Designs

Creating SVG designs is an opportunity to unleash creativity and innovation. When crafting unique SVG designs, it’s essential to consider the visual impact, scalability, and adaptability of the design. By using vector graphics, designers can ensure that their creations look sharp and clear at any size without losing quality. This is particularly important when creating logos, icons, or illustrations that will be used across different platforms and devices.

Utilizing Interactive SVG Designs

SVG designs have the potential to be highly interactive and engaging. By incorporating animations, hover effects, and clickable elements into SVG designs, creators can bring their designs to life and create a unique user experience. Whether it’s an animated illustration or an interactive infographic, the use of SVG designs can enhance the visual appeal and interactivity of the content.
